Where they differ
The 20 capabilities (of 56 in the retail taxonomy) where the evidence separates them, biggest gaps first. “Not evidenced” means our research found no public documentation of this capability — the vendor may still offer it. Confirm on a demo.
| Capability | ||
|---|---|---|
| Product & merchandise hierarchyMerchandising & Master Data | Not evidenced | Core strength Retail-native data models for style-color-size hierarchies |
| True landed cost capturePurchasing & Supplier Management | Not evidenced | Core strength True landed cost capture: base price, freight, vendor allowances, duties and rebates |
| Regular price managementPricing & Promotions | Not evidenced | Core strength Pricing strategy deployment by margin, hierarchy or zone |
| Promotional & clearance pricingPricing & Promotions | Not evidenced | Core strength Regular pricing, promotional campaigns, markdowns and clearance events in one system |
| Real-time margin visibilityPricing & Promotions | Not evidenced | Core strength Named flagship: Real-Time Margin Visibility with item-level margin ahead of pricing decisions |
| AI-driven anomaly detectionReporting & Analytics | Not evidenced | Core strength AI agents monitor operations and detect anomalies before they cascade |
| Conversational / natural-language analyticsReporting & Analytics | Not evidenced | Core strength Conversational intelligence answering natural-language queries about SKU performance, margin and supplier compliance |
| Agentic AI assistantsPlatform, Integration & AI | Not evidenced | Core strength Named flagship: AI agents monitor operations, reconcile invoices and generate recommended actions |
| Promotional calendar managementMerchandising & Master Data | Not evidenced | Supported Promotional calendar management |
| Vendor deal, rebate & allowance managementPurchasing & Supplier Management | Not evidenced | Supported Vendor allowance and rebate tracking |
| Rules-based allocation engineInventory & Allocation | Supported AF&R: stock allocation aligned to revenue, markdown and margin goals | Not evidenced |
| Demand forecasting & replenishmentInventory & Allocation | Core strength AF&R: automated forecast algorithm selection, self-adjustment, SKU-level forecasts | Partial Order generation based on demand signals; no dedicated forecasting module documented |
| Cycle counts & inventory auditsInventory & Allocation | Not evidenced | Supported Mobile inventory counts and audits |
| Automated markdown executionPricing & Promotions | Not evidenced | Supported Automated pricing execution across banners and store formats |
| Cross-channel price consistencyPricing & Promotions | Not evidenced | Supported Detection of pricing inconsistencies before they reach the shelf |
| Zone / location-based pricingPricing & Promotions | Not evidenced | Supported Pricing strategy deployment by margin, hierarchy or zone |
| Performance dashboardsReporting & Analytics | Supported Actionable merchandising analytics | Not evidenced |
| Payment processor & tax engine integrationsPlatform, Integration & AI | Supported Named tax (Avalara, Vertex) and payment (Adyen, Verifone, Ingenico, Chase, Opayo) technology partners | Not evidenced |
| Integrated accounts payable matchingPurchasing & Supplier Management | Supported Integrated Accounts Payable matching | Partial Invoice/PO/receipt reconciliation automated; no separate AP system integration named |
| Multi-node network visibilityInventory & Allocation | Partial Optional WMS module covers receiving and cross-docking, not full DC/3PL network view | Not evidenced |
